Arkose is a sedimentary rock, specifically a type of sandstone containing at least 25% feldspar

From Auvergne region of France used by a French geologist Alexandre Brongniart in 1826 who applied this term to some feldspathic sandstones

Adamellite is a coarse-grained porphyritic igneous rock, a variety of Monzogranite and dominated by phenocrysts of orthoclase in a granular groundmass of perthite, plagioclase and quartz

From German adamellit and from Monte Adamello, a mountain in Italy, its locality
